The Cahn-Ingold-Prelog (CIP) sequence rules are used to assign priority to different groups attached to a chiral center in a molecule. The priority is determined based on atomic number, with higher atomic numbers receiving higher priority.

Here are the steps to determine which group has the highest priority:

  1. Identify the atoms directly attached to the chiral center. The atom with the highest atomic number gets the highest priority.

  2. If there is a tie, move to the atoms one step away from the chiral center. Again, the group with the atom of highest atomic number gets the higher priority.

  3. If there is still a tie, continue moving away from the chiral center until the tie is broken.

  4. If all atoms are the same, then the group with the most branches gets the higher priority.

  5. If there is still a tie, then the group with the most double or triple bonds gets the higher priority.

So, without knowing the specific groups in your molecule, it's impossible to say which group has the highest priority. However, groups containing atoms with higher atomic numbers (like iodine or bromine) will generally have higher priority than groups containing atoms with lower atomic numbers (like hydrogen or carbon).
